A round-up of this weekend’s iPad pre-order news.

This past Friday night Hong Kong time was the official date for the pre-order for the Apple iPad. You still have to wait until April 3rd to have it delivered but the buzz is out of control, as usual with various reports coming in from different sources.
Brainstorm Tech says Apple sold 120,000+ in the first day:
- Customers preferred the cheaper WiFi version (the 3G one doesn’t ship until the end of April)
- Orders were split over the 16GB, 32GB and 64GB models.
- Apple made US$75million in one day on a product no one can touch yet.
